Abstract
We present two miniature all plastic megapixel panomorph lenses for consumer electronics (total track length (TTL) of 6.56 mm) and mobile devices (TTL of 3.80 mm) showing the unique challenges from specification, design, manufacturing and testing phases of these new generation of miniature 180° FoV wide-angle lenses.
